We’re looking for an Instrumentation Specialist who can own end-to-end tracking implementation and ensure clean, reliable event measurement across ad platforms, CRMs, and client websites. This role goes well beyond basic pixel setup. It requires strong technical judgment, QA discipline, and comfort working directly with code when needed.

You’ll partner closely with account managers and clients to understand tracking requirements, implement solutions, and validate data accuracy across systems. If you sit comfortably at the intersection of marketing, analytics, and engineering, this role will be a strong fit.

What You’ll Work On

Tracking Setup and Instrumentation

  • Configure and maintain GTM, Meta Pixel, Google Ads conversion tracking, and related platforms
  • Implement and QA event tracking across websites, CMS platforms, CRMs, and ecommerce systems
  • Validate conversion events, UTMs, and attribution logic across platforms
  • Ensure tracking is accurate, consistent, and resilient to site or platform changes

Technical Integration and Implementation

  • Integrate tracking with CRMs and systems such as HubSpot, Salesforce, Recruiterflow, or GoHighLevel
  • Work directly in client codebases when tag managers are insufficient
  • Implement and troubleshoot tracking in React and TypeScript environments
  • Diagnose and resolve cross-platform data flow issues

Quality Assurance and Documentation

  • Test and verify all tracking implementations before handoff
  • Produce clear documentation outlining setups, assumptions, and limitations
  • Share QA findings and walkthroughs with internal teams and clients

Collaboration and Client Support

  • Gather tracking requirements in partnership with account managers
  • Communicate technical concepts clearly to non-technical stakeholders
  • Proactively recommend improvements to tracking accuracy and reporting reliability

What You Bring

  • 3 to 5+ years of experience in tracking instrumentation, analytics implementation, or technical ad operations
  • Strong hands-on experience with Google Tag Manager, Meta Pixel, and Google Ads tracking
  • Comfort working with JavaScript and TypeScript, including React-based codebases
  • Proven ability to troubleshoot complex tracking and attribution issues
  • Clear written and verbal communication skills across technical and non-technical teams

Nice to Have

  • Experience with server-side GTM or advanced tracking architectures
  • Agency or client-facing experience supporting multiple tracking environments
  • Familiarity with broader MarTech stacks and analytics ecosystems
